From Transformation to Calibration
For years, beauty standards leaned heavily on transformation: fuller lips, sculpted cheekbones, wrinkle-free foreheads. But the aesthetic pendulum is swinging back. Clients are now seeking subtle recalibrations rather than dramatic overhauls. It’s no longer about becoming someone else — it’s about becoming the most refined, rested, radiant version of yourself.
Psychologically, this shift is profound. We’re moving away from chasing perfection and toward cultivating authenticity. Beauty is no longer defined by symmetry or youth, but by energy, confidence, and harmony.
Invisible Touch: The New Gold Standard
In today’s high-standard clinics, the artistry lies in making results invisible to the eye but impactful to the self. Treatments focus on:
Skin quality over quantity: Think deep hydration, collagen stimulation, and subtle radiance boosts rather than volume overload.
Micro-lifts, not face-freezes: Facial massage, myofascial work, EMS (electrical muscle stimulation), and intradermal boosters are preferred to create lift and glow without stiffness.
Holistic harmony: Instead of chasing one feature, the entire face — including the neck, jawline, and even posture — is considered in the treatment plan.
In this new landscape, overfilled lips or overly taut foreheads are seen as outdated. Instead, people are investing in advanced techniques that whisper, not shout.
The Psychology of “Just Enough”
Why is this subtlety so powerful?
Because our brains are wired to detect micro-expressions — tiny facial movements that convey trust, emotion, and connection. When treatments are too strong or obvious, they disrupt these cues, making faces look less expressive or, ironically, less alive.
In contrast, the “undetectable” approach preserves expression and identity. It’s not about denying age — it’s about making time feel irrelevant.
